#d70962 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d70962 is composed of 84.3% red, 3.5% green and 38.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 95.8% magenta, 54.4% yellow and 15.7% black. It has a hue angle of 334.1 degrees, a saturation of 92% and a lightness of 43.9%. #d70962 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ff12c4 with #af0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

Shades and Tints of #d70962
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080004 is the darkest color, while #fff4f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d70962
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#78686f is the less saturated color, while #e00061 is the most saturated one.
